How to Create a Blog Page
Introduction
Blog pages are static pages on your site—About, Resources, Legal, or custom landings—distinct from dated posts in the Posts tab. On systeme.io, you add them under Sites → Blogs → Pages → Create, then design them in the visual editor like funnel pages.

Default Pages When You Create a Blog
When you create a new blog, systeme.io generates sample pages (typically Home, About, Posts listing, Contact, and Search, depending on template).
- Home page, Post list page, and Search page — mandatory (cannot delete)
- About and Contact — can be edited or deleted if you replace them
Edit defaults via the three dots → Edit, or add new pages alongside them.
Step 1: Open the Pages Section
- Go to Sites
- Click Blogs
- Click your blog’s name
- In the blog menu, open Pages
Step 2: Create a New Blog Page
- Click Create
- Enter the Blog page name (internal/admin label and default title)
- Enter the URL path (e.g.
/resourcesor/about-me) - Click Create a blog page to save
Your new page appears in the list. You can change name and path later via three dots → Settings on systeme.io.
Step 3: Edit and Manage the Page
Use the three dots menu on each page:
- View — preview as a visitor
- Edit — open the page editor (add rows, text, images, forms)
- Duplicate — copy the page
- Don’t use blog layout — page uses its own layout instead of the shared blog template
- Settings — change page name and URL path
- Delete — remove the page (not available for mandatory pages)
Save changes in the editor before exiting. Link new pages in your blog menu.
Pages vs Posts
Posts ( create a blog post) are articles with publish dates, categories, and RSS updates. Pages are fixed URLs for evergreen content. Use pages for legal text, team bios, or tool lists; use posts for SEO articles.
Troubleshooting
Cannot delete a page
Home, Post list, and Search are required for blog structure.
404 on new path
Check URL path spelling; avoid conflicting with category or post slugs.
Page looks wrong vs rest of site
Keep blog layout enabled, or customize via Blog layout for global chrome.
